While it is crucial to note that NAD+ is technically a naturally occurring coenzyme and not a peptide, it is frequently grouped into this category within research circles due to the similarities in storage and handling.
When exploring what is nad 500mg, the primary focus for researchers is its role as an essential redox coenzyme and signaling molecule. It is heavily utilized in studies involving mitochondrial function, sirtuin activity, and cellular metabolism.
